The astonishing Marion Carll Farmhouse on Long Island was built in 1860 in modern day Suffolk County, New York. An enchanting time capsule, the Marion Carll Farmhouse on Long Island has lain empty for years due to a lack of funding and a legal battle over ownership rights. The Long Island Rail Road has recently abandoned a number of stations In Queens and Nassau.Many of these stations are along the Montauk Branch between Jamaica and Long Island City.
